Birth control pills and severe nausea. What do you need to know to avoid it?

  1. Select another type of COCs with low dosage or “mini-pills” that don’t cause nausea or cause less nausea. Contraceptive pills containing 20 mcg of estrogen significantly reduce the intensity of nausea but at the same time increase the risk of intermenstrual bleeding, spotting, and amenorrhea;
  2. You may have a spontaneous disappearance or decrease in the intensity of nausea during the first months of taking drugs;
  3. Take the tablets at night or at bedtime;
  4. Be sure to take an extra contraceptive tablet if you have nausea and vomiting immediately after taking birth control pills;
  5. Exclude pregnancy by determining chorionic gonadotropin in the urine (pregnancy test) or in the blood.
